Transaction 5a14cd4faf692c175e065f54d378488d3008468961a1c0aa103edd69339b9ee1
1 Input
1 Output
-
5a14cd4faf692c175e065f54d378488d3008468961a1c0aa103edd69339b9ee1:0
- value
- 1066664
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 fdcb85b44f184c80d2794fb9f273968697e24004f657e781403c056446eda15e
- address
- bc1plh9ctdz0rpxgp5nef7ulyuuks6t7ysqy7et70q2q8szkg3hd590qkh67sg